What Is P2P Trading and Why Buy USDT via P2P Platforms?
Peer-to-peer (P2P) trading allows users to buy and sell cryptocurrencies directly without intermediaries. USDT (Tether) is a popular stablecoin pegged to the US dollar, offering stability in volatile markets. In Uzbekistan, P2P platforms provide a convenient way to purchase USDT using local payment methods. Why Use P2P Platforms to Buy USDT in Uzbekistan?
- Local Currency Support: Trade Uzbekistani som (UZS) directly for USDT.
- Lower Fees: Avoid high fees charged by traditional exchanges.
- Flexible Payment Options: Use bank transfers, cash, or mobile wallets like Paynet.
- Privacy: Maintain anonymity compared to centralized exchanges.
How to Buy USDT via P2P Platforms: Step-by-Step
- Choose a Reliable Platform: Opt for Binance P2P, LocalBitcoins, or Paxful.
- Create an Account: Sign up and complete identity verification (KYC).
- Search for Sellers: Filter sellers by payment method, price, and reputation.
- Initiate a Trade: Select USDT amount, confirm details, and lock the price.
- Make Payment: Transfer funds via the seller’s preferred method and mark as paid.
- Receive USDT: The seller releases USDT to your wallet after confirming payment.

5 Tips to Safely Buy USDT via P2P
- Verify seller ratings and transaction history.
- Use platforms with escrow services to prevent fraud.
- Avoid off-platform payments to reduce scams.
- Double-check wallet addresses before confirming transfers.
- Start with small amounts to test the process.
